Everything Worth Something Needs a Little TLC

The Tower Garden is no exception to this!  growing 28 plants in a small area produces some fantastic results when done with the Tower Garden, but there is some upkeep when the storms roll on through.

I dream one day of a screened in porch for many reasons, but until then our Tower Garden resides on the deck and is subject to the great winds that sweep down the straight wind tunnel created by the houses here.

Our Tomato Cage was damages in such a storm last week and we went to Lowe's to find a replacement.  The right diameter wooden dowels rods did the trick and all for less that $2!    



Through all of the storms and scorching sun this Indiana summer, our Tower is still producing lots and LOTS of produce!  I am not sure what to do with all of these tomatoes!  Our traditional garden's are bringing in about ten now, but we are getting about 5-10 a day from the Tower.  The brocolli is growing like crazy too and the leaves are edible and SO big!

Can you see all the tomatoes?  This is just one quarter of the Tower.  Tomatoes are all around!

We have peppers!  Hot peppers and bell peppers are sprouting up!


Our summer crop is starting to wind down and though we put some new ones in there, I think we are going to stop putting new in for now, harvest it all and then give it a GOOD CLEANING!  Then we will either leave it out for longer or move it in for it's winter home inside depending on weather.  Can't wait to share with all of you how the winter goes!
